Flow Cytometry: Sodium Potassium ATPase Alpha 1 Antibody (464.6) [NB300-146] - An intracellular stain was performed on A549 cells with Sodium Potassium ATPase Alpha 1 Antibody (464.6) NB300-146 and a matched isotype control. Cells were fixed with 4% PFA and then permeablized with 0.1% saponin. Cells were incubated in an antibody dilution of 1 ug/mL for 30 minutes at room temperature, followed by mouse F(ab)2 IgG (H+L) APC-conjugated secondary antibody (F0101B, R&D Systems).
Immunocytochemistry/Immunofluorescence: Sodium Potassium ATPase Alpha 1 Antibody (464.6) [NB300-146] - Hek293 cells were fixed for 10 minutes using 10% formalin and then permeabilized for 5 minutes using 1X TBS + 0.5% Triton-X100. The cells were incubated with anti-Sodium Potassium ATPase Alpha 1 (464.6) at 10 ug/ml overnight at 4C and detected with an anti-mouse Dylight 488 (Green) at a 1:500 dilution. Actin was detected with Phalloidin 568 (Red) at a 1:200 dilution. Nuclei were counterstained with DAPI (Blue). Cells were imaged using a 40X objective.
Immunocytochemistry/Immunofluorescence: Sodium Potassium ATPase Alpha 1 Antibody (464.6) [NB300-146] - HeLa cells were fixed for 10 minutes using 10% formalin and then permeabilized for 5 minutes using 1X TBS + 0.5% Triton-X100. The cells were incubated with anti-Sodium Potassium ATPase Alpha 1 (464.6) at 10 ug/ml overnight at 4C and detected with an anti-mouse Dylight 488 (Green) at a 1:500 dilution. Actin was detected with Phalloidin 568 (Red) at a 1:200 dilution. Nuclei were counterstained with DAPI (Blue). Cells were imaged using a 40X objective.

Background

Sodium Potassium ATPase alpha 1 (ATP1A1) belongs to the P-type ATPase family and is the catalytic component of the active enzyme, which catalyzes the hydrolysis of ATP coupled with exchange of sodium (Na+) and potassium (K+ ) ions across the cellular plasma membranes. This action creates an electrochemical gradient of Na+ and K+ ions, providing the energy for active transport of various nutrients. Its phosphorylation at Tyr-10 position alters the pumping activity whereas dephosphorylation mediated by PP2A (protein phosphatase 2A) following increases in intracellular Na+, leads to catalytic activity. Because the plasma membrane is highly permeable to water, it is the concentration of ions across this membrane that is critical for maintaining an adequate cell volume and sodium potassium ATPase is key player in this maintainance process because it provides the driving force for active Na+ as well as K+ transport into/out of the cell, with water following isosmotically. This pump is consists of equimolar ratios of two main subunits, the catalytic alpha subunit (which contains the binding sites for the mentioned cations, ATP, and cardiotonic steroid inhibitors) and the regulatory beta polypeptides (which is essential for the normal activity of the enzyme as well as involved potentially in the occlusion of K+ and modulation of the enzyme's K+ /Na+ affinity).
